Took the whole family to Big Bend Backcountry.
We went Outer Mountain Loop sections from the Chisos side starting at 6:50 AM. Dry air and steady sun meant layers changed fast after sunrise. Tread was dry and clear with a few loose rock corners.
Short version: Take photos of the permit.
Worth every bit of effort.
